Beispiel #1
0
 [Test] // uint8[] array8;   5
 public void CheckSimpleUintArray()
 {
     /* uintArray.push(12);
     *  uintArray.push(14);
     *  uintArray.push(15); */
     TestUtility.CheckArrayItem(0, TestUtility.CheckValueFunction, variableList[5 + startInd], new TestUtility.CheckValues
     {
         parentName = "array8",
         value      = "12"
     });
     TestUtility.CheckArrayItem(1, TestUtility.CheckValueFunction, variableList[5 + startInd], new TestUtility.CheckValues
     {
         parentName = "array8",
         value      = "14"
     });
     TestUtility.CheckArrayItem(2, TestUtility.CheckValueFunction, variableList[5 + startInd], new TestUtility.CheckValues
     {
         parentName = "array8",
         value      = "15"
     });
 }
Beispiel #2
0
 //SimpleStruct[] arrayStruct; 5
 public void CheckArrayStruct()
 {
     TestUtility.CheckArrayItem(0, TestUtility.StructCheckFunction, variableList[6 + startInd], new TestUtility.CheckValues
     {
         parentName = "arrayStruct",
         nameValues = new List <TestUtility.NameValues>
         {
             {
                 new TestUtility.NameValues {
                     Name = "slot0off0", Value = "23"
                 }
             },
             {
                 new TestUtility.NameValues {
                     Name = "slot0off8", Value = "14"
                 }
             },
             {
                 new TestUtility.NameValues {
                     Name = "slot1off130", Value = "25"
                 }
             }
         }
     });
     TestUtility.CheckArrayItem(1, TestUtility.StructCheckFunction, variableList[6 + startInd], new TestUtility.CheckValues
     {
         parentName = "arrayStruct",
         nameValues = new List <TestUtility.NameValues>
         {
             {
                 new TestUtility.NameValues {
                     Name = "slot0off0", Value = "20"
                 }
             },
             {
                 new TestUtility.NameValues {
                     Name = "slot0off8", Value = "18"
                 }
             },
             {
                 new TestUtility.NameValues {
                     Name = "slot1off130", Value = "22"
                 }
             }
         }
     });
     TestUtility.CheckArrayItem(2, TestUtility.StructCheckFunction, variableList[6 + startInd], new TestUtility.CheckValues
     {
         parentName = "arrayStruct",
         nameValues = new List <TestUtility.NameValues>
         {
             {
                 new TestUtility.NameValues {
                     Name = "slot0off0", Value = "30"
                 }
             },
             {
                 new TestUtility.NameValues {
                     Name = "slot0off8", Value = "33"
                 }
             },
             {
                 new TestUtility.NameValues {
                     Name = "slot1off130", Value = "34"
                 }
             }
         }
     });
 }